My Cactus Heart

My Cactus Heart is a pinoy romantic movie that was released on January 25, 2012. The movie was directed by Enrico Santos.

The pinoy movie stars Maja Salvador with Matteo Guidicelli. Introducing in the film in his first movie appearance is Xian Lim.

The movie is distributed by Star Cinema and Skylight Films.

The movie's summary:
Sandy (Maja Salvador) is a hopeless romantic who has dumped many boyfriends and also rejected a number of suitors. Her life changes when she meets Bene (Xian Lim), a handsome heartthrob, at work. However, her friend Carlo (Matteo Guidicelli) will do everything to have her reciprocate his affection.

A Mother's Story

A Mother's Story is a heart-warming drama movie starring Pokwang.

The film is produced by TFC(The Filipino Channel) and distributed by ABS-CBN International and Star Cinema.

The movie is directed by John D. Lazatin.

With Pokwang in the movie are Xyriel Manabat, Rayver Cruz, Nonie Buencamino, Beth Tamayo, Daria Ramirez, Ana Capri, Jaime Fabregas, Aaron Junatas, K Brosas, Atty. Michael J. Gurfinkel, Erik Sundquist, Rheem Abuhamdeh, Susan McCarthy, and Veronica Louise Mendoza.

The film's Official Synopsis:
Medy (Pokwang), a make-up artist, was given the chance of a lifetime to accompany a concert star to the United States for a performance. She promised her family that she will return after a week. However, while in America, she stumbled upon a former classmate Helen (Beth Tamayo) who convinced her to stay for good in the land of milk and honey. She initially refused, but eventually gave in, when she got a call one night from her husband that they need a big amount of money to bring her youngest daughter to the hospital. America has not been the friendliest to her and our story begins with her coming home to Manila literally with nothing.

Medy’s two kids, King (Rayver Cruz) and Queenie (Xyriel Manabat) are now 19 and 7. King struggles with the return of his mother. Animosity, resentment, shame, and anger are issues he has built with Medy. For the young Queenie, it’s getting to know Nanay… who she thought would one day come out of a Balikbayan Box. And as for her husband, Medy discovers something she least expected.

How will Medy put her life and that of her family’s back together, now that she’s back after 7 long years?

The Road (2011)

The Road is a Filipino psychological-horror film starring Carmina Villaroel, Marvin Agustin, Rhian Ramos, and TJ Trinidad.

This movie is directed by the internationally-acclaimed director Yam Laranas.

The film was released by GMA Films in the Philippines and Freestyle Releasing in the United States.

Here is the film's Official Plot:
The Road is about a 12 year-old cold case which is reopened when three teenagers went missing in an abandoned road. In the course of the investigation, deeper and gruesome stories of abduction and murders are discovered. After more than two decades, the secrets and mysteries of the road are finally revealed and the spirit lingering the dark and desolate pathway is out to make sure nobody leaves alive.

Won't Last A Day Without You

Won't Last A Day Without You is a 2011 romantic movie starring Sarah Geronimo and Gerald Anderson. It was their second team up in a movie. The first movie they we're paired on was in "Catch Me I'm In Love".

This film was produced by Star Cinema and Viva Films and directed by Raz dela Torre.

Here's the official synopsis of the film:
Awarded radio personality George Harrison Apostol, known as DJ Heidee to her listeners (Sarah Geronimo), provides love advice to people who are having problems in their relationships. DJ Heidee receives a call from a girl named Melissa (Megan Young) who is asking advice on how to break up with her boyfriend Andrew (Gerald Anderson). Unfortunately, Andrew is listening to the same program and hears Heidee telling Melissa how they should break up. Andrew blames Heidee for what happened and even threatens to sue her for giving that particular advice. In order to prevent a legal battle, and to ease her conscience, Heidee decides to help Andrew win Melissa back. In the process of getting the two together, Andrew and Heidee begin to feel an attraction toward each other. Will they be able to overcome their past and become lovers instead?

Aswang (2011)

Aswang is a 2011 horror-suspense film produced and distributed by Regal Films.

The film is directed by Jerrold Tarog and Actress Lovi Poe stars the film while Paulo Avelino is her leading man.

The movie did not do well on it's opening day and the rest of it's campaign maybe because Regal Films did not go all out in promoting this film.

Praybeyt Benjamin

Praybeyt Benjamin is a 2011 Filipino comedy film starring Vice Ganda.

This movie was produced by Star Cinema and Viva Films and is considered as the Philippines' highest grossing film of all time beating No Other Woman.

Other casts include Jimmy Santos, Eddie Garcia, Nikki Valdez, Vandolph Quizon, and Derek Ramsay who also starred in the movie No Other Woman.

The film is directed by Wenn V. Deramas. Sources say that a sequel to this film is in the works.

No Other Woman

ABS-CBN's No Other Woman is a 2011 Pinoy romance-drama film starring Derek Ramsay, Anne Curtis, and Cristine Reyes.

It was produced by Star Cinema and Viva Films and made huge numbers in it's 1st week.

It is directed by Ruel S. Bayani.

My Neighbor's Wife

My Neighbor's Wife is a sexy drama film about marital infedility between two modern young couples.

The movie is produced and distributed by Regal Films.

Written and Directed by Jun Lana, the film didn't do much compared to Star Cinema's No Other Woman.

Leading roles include Dennis Trillo, Lovi Poe, Jake Cuenca, and Carla Abellana.
